One of my favorite directoors is Tim Burton. :rock:
For those of you who dont know his name here is a list of a few of his films.

1.The Nightmare Before Christmas
2.Sleepy Hollow
3.Beetlejuice
4.Big Fish
5.Edward Scissorhands
6.The Addams Family
7.Batman
8.Batman Returns
